Output a32d4656714963eec6e91eb48bc6d8260abf7aebd4ad7ee7201eeecce0de8774:29

value
53566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a99251b098e26aa51af66ec08c795aa3a96687ec OP_EQUAL
address
3H9dQPiUR3XVvzeJfgYpr3ZMsd5eQbtkPf
transaction
a32d4656714963eec6e91eb48bc6d8260abf7aebd4ad7ee7201eeecce0de8774
confirmations
230996
spent
true